Zanetti: Cambiasso Crying

MILAN - Inter Milan drew 2-2 match over Catania menyisakkan stories. Some incidents are very uplifting expressed by the Inter captain Javier Zanetti.
 
At the match, Inter rise from adversity after trailing 0-2 in the first round by Alejandro Gomez scored in the 19th minute and Mariano Izco in the 38th minute.
 
"Seeing how the situation, we showed great character. That's not easy, as Catania beat us hard with two quick goals, after we started the game well, "said Zanetti, as reported by Football-Italy, Monday (05/03/2012).
 
Zanetti Inter had said that the rise was no doubt of several factors, among which is the motivation of his team mate Julio Cesar who gave motivation to the entire team.
 
"In the locker room, Julio Cesar gave us a talk to the whole team and I have to praise him for his efforts. We were able to find the strength to fight, "said the captain.
 
But the situation was tense in the second half when coach Claudio Ranieri surprisingly replacing Esteban Cambiasso with Andrea Poli at minute 61. At that time the fans cheered as he immediately disagreed with the decision of the coach. Looking at the fan response, according to the view Zanetti, Cambiasso was crying.
 
"You have to ask the coach if it was the right decision to replace someone who has won so many titles. If Ranieri made ​​his choice, he must have a reason, "Zanetti said.
 
"We have to understand the mood of the fans and unfortunately we have lost a lot of games. At the final whistle to thank my fans, because they are very important in motivating us, "he said.
